0040h:0013h           Memory Size in Kilobytes (0-640)

Length: 2 bytes

Contains the number of contiguous 1K memory blocks in the system
(up to 640K).

──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

Use Int 12h to access the memory size using the ROM BIOS
interface.

This memory value is determined at power-on time by either
examining the DIP switches on the system board or using the value
stored in the CMOS battery, whichever way is appropriate according
to the type of machine.

This is the amount of memory available to the entire system. This
is not the amount of memory available to the user's program. Use
Int 21h, Function 48h, to determine the amount of memory available
to a user's program.

To determine the amount of memory above the 1024K address range,
use Int 15h, Service 88h.

If the CMOS battery memory value or the DIP switch value is
greater than the actual amount of memory, then the actual amount
of memory is returned by this interrupt.
